Question 3 of 5

A nurse is calculating the output of an infant admitted who has dehydration. When weighing the diaper, the nurse should equate 1 g of wet diaper weight to which of the following amounts of urine?

Correct Answer: B

Rationale: It is a standard practice to equate 1 gram of wet diaper weight to 1 mL of urine providing an accurate measure for fluid balance in infants.
